GLENDALOUGH HERMITAGE CENTRE 

Pilgrim Walks Saturday 31st May 2025 

Following the tradition of pilgrimage, a series of walks has been organised to mark St Kevin’s Day in Glendalough. Participants will walk towards Glendalough following a choice of 8 different routes which will merge along the way with other walkers from the same area.

If you’re thinking of walking all you need to do is- 

Pick one of the routes and then contact the group leader who will give you the details on the route’s length, starting time, location etc. Each person will walk all or part of their chosen route finishing with a ‘gathering’ of walkers sharing refreshments at the Hermitage Centre near St Kevin’s Church, Laragh after 2pm
